Microprocessor heatsink and fan assembly
Prerequisite
Before you start, read Appendix A "Important safety information" on page 73 and print the following
instructions.
The heatsink might be very hot. Before you open the computer cover, turn off the computer and wait several
minutes until the computer is cool.
Notes:
• The microprocessor heatsink and fan assembly included with your computer will be one of the two models
illustrated below. Follow the same procedures for both models.
• Any warranty replacements will only cover the specific model of heatsink and fan included with your
computer. The images provided are for reference only.
Replacement procedure
1. Remove the power cord. See "Power cord" on page 26.
2. Remove the left side cover. See "Left side cover" on page 27.
3. Remove the fan power cable from the motherboard.
4. Unscrew the heatsink mounting screws.
Note: Carefully remove the screws from the system board to avoid any possible damage to the system
board. The screws cannot be removed from the heatsink.
